FOREST VIEW HIGH SCHOOL

Forest View High School was a high school located in southern Arlington Heights, Illinois, that opened in 1962 and closed twenty-four years later in 1986.  High School District 214 enrollment in 1962 was 6,323. The school was the third high school built for Township High School District 214, and was the second high school to close, after Arlington High School closed first in 1984. Enrollment in 1984 was 13,742, about the same as the enrollment in 1968 (13,520).  Enrollment in District 214 in 1986 was 12,447.

The school mascot was Ferdie the Falcon, and the school colors were silver, black, and gold.
